Which vehicles are applicable to the Kumho Solus TA31?
Kumho Solus TA31 Tire offers a wide range of sizes and applications. The sizes of these tires range from 14 inches to 20 inches. It is solid for vehicles like Acura TL, TSX, and RSX, BMW 1 Series, 3 Series, and 5 Series, Ford Fusion, Chevrolet Malibu and Impala, Nissan Ultima and Maxima, Subaru Impreza, Legacy. safe option, and Outback car, Toyota Camry car and Avalon, Volvo S40 and S80, and Honda Civic acr and Accord car.
This tire is also a great choice for smaller crossovers like the Hyundai Kona, Mazda CX-3, Honda HR-V, and Subaru Crossroads.

How long should Kumho Solus tires last
The lifespan of Kumho Solus tires, including the TA31 model, can vary depending on factors like driving habits, road conditions, and maintenance. On average, you can expect these tires to last between 40,000 to 60,000 miles, but this can differ based on usage. Regular maintenance, proper tire rotation, and alignment can help maximize their longevity.

What is the mileage rating of Kumho Solus TA31?
The mileage rating for Kumho Solus TA31 tires can vary depending on the specific tire size and type (e.g., touring or performance). Typically, these tires come with a mileage warranty ranging from 40,000 to 75,000 miles. It’s important to check the specific mileage rating provided by Kumho for the exact tire size and model you are considering.
